There is a technique I was taught in drivers ed called "ground viewing" where if you're wondering if someone is about to change lanes look at their front tires in relation to the lane markings, a lot of people as soon as they even think about changing lanes start to subconsciously drift in that direction. The reason you look at the ground is because it's easier for eyes to spot the very small amount of movement between the line and the tire as they are close to each other and the tire moves in relation to the lane marking. Everything else in your field of vision is either far away from the car or might move in relation to it like other vehicles so it is harder to tell.
The subconscious feeling you get they're about to change lanes is from this slight movement and ground viewing allows you to check. I spot most people are going to change lanes before their blinker is even on when people change lanes safely as in put blinker on, check the lane is clear and then move over, it makes it really easy to spot. Obviously the caveat is to not get carried away staring at the ground and tires of the car beside you, this is just a quick look.
Another defensive driving technique I was glad I got taught was to look *past* the car in front of you if you can at all. Even if it's literally looking "through" their car between the gaps of their seats and out their front windshield. If that car starts to slow you'll notice anyway but looking ahead of it lets you see potential problems coming before they even brake. I've avoided a couple accidents where I saw the lane was stopped ahead, changed lanes *safely* and the car I was behind didn't notice and plowed right into them.
